The Phoenix Contact PCB connector designed to facilitate reliable connections in various electronic applications. With its robust build and innovative design, this connector provides a secure interface for a range of wiring configurations. Ideal for use in environments where durability is essential, it features a comprehensive locking mechanism and a latching flange for added stability during operation. The connector supports a nominal current of 12 A and ensures excellent electrical performance across various operating conditions, making it a trusted choice for professionals in the field. Its compact design, alongside a nominal cross section of 2.5 mm², allows for efficient use of space, ideal for modern circuit board layouts. The carefully selected materials ensure high resistance to environmental stresses, providing extended service life and reliability in challenging applications.

Compact design optimises space utilisation on circuit boards
Snap-in locking mechanism enhances security against accidental disconnection
Latching flange construction provides additional support during installation
Crimp connection method facilitates easy assembly with flexible conductor cross sections
Robust housing materials ensure reliability in harsh environmental conditions
Intuitive pull-out aid simplifies handling and reduces tensile stress on connections
Compatible with a wide range of conductive materials for greater versatility
Environmentally compliant to RoHS and REACH directives for safer operation
